Late 19th Century American Weavers Chair with Traces of Old Red Paint
Nice late 19th century American weavers chair with traces of old red paint. Round legs with 2 rungs on 3 sides and 1 rung on the back. The chair slightly splays back to 2 tombstone shaped back slats and dog eared ends on the back stays. Split hickory woven seat.
Measures 33.25? in height and 13.5? in depth
